Pioneers of Sustainable California Caviar

  (UNITED STATES, 2/17/2021)

While the sturgeon has been around for 200 million years, it wasn’t until the past decade that the market for caviar began to get interesting.

In September of 2007, California Caviar Company (CCC) launched the first sustainable caviar company in the world and the industry has not been the same since.

From its inception, California Caviar has been true to its core mission: sustainability, innovation and education. Linking old world traditions with the new world of sustainable aquaculture and culinary innovation, CCC has become a global leader in the production of sustainably farmed, premium caviar, sought after by Michelin Star chefs, discriminating connoisseurs, and those just discovering the joy of caviar.

Every jar of caviar has a tracking number that allows to trace every egg back to the farm, fish and harvest date.

“The genesis of California Caviar Company was a direct response to consumer demand for a safe, reliable purveyor of high-quality caviar. Our mission is to provide a premium sustainable product that is controlled and guaranteed so our clients can trust and trace every egg from tank to tin,”  says Deborah Keane, CCC founder and CEO.

A pioneer of the sustainable caviar movement, Keane founded California Caviar Company to address the lack of reliable supply in the marketplace. CCC was born out of necessity due to the domestic caviar crisis in early 2000s, an error that was marked by the depletion of wild stocks and an increase in illegally sourced product.

Deborah Keane—the “Caviar Queen”—a renowned tastemaker and caviar master has built a complete, vertically integrated spawning-to-serving enterprise.

In 2007, CCC launch the first caviar company to only sell sustainably farmed caviar years before the worldwide ban on wild sturgeon in 2011. The CCC initials and linked logo not only represent the company's name but also stand for Company Connecting Change, linking the old world traditions and mystique with the new world of innovation and sustainable aquaculture.

CCC owns the U.S. master patent for the Köhler Process, allowing to use first ever techniques for caviar extraction without harming the sturgeon, pioneered by Prof. Dr. Angela Köhler. CCC sustainable mission is moving forward by producing the first-ever only living caviar (also known as “no-kill” caviar) to the United States in 2021. Once approved by the FDA, CCC will be able to massage the fish to extract the precious eggs and will continue to set the national standards for sustainable caviar.

What sets CCC apart in the caviar industry is that its farm is completely sustainable in its nature and operation. The infinity loop model, takes natural water sources from the company's own aquifers on property to supply the tanks and ponds. After it filters through the farm, the nutrient rich water goes to CCC's neighbors to irrigate their fields for their cattle, later seeping back into the ground to replenish the mineral rich aquifers. CCC's  model has been touted by US Fish and wildlife department and used as an example for sustainable/ optimal farming partnerships.

With the proliferation of caviar farms throughout the world, Deborah has traveled the globe selecting and making caviar with the highest caliber caviar farms throughout North America, Asia, Europe and the Middle East. Aware that farming conditions are critical to the ultimate quality of caviar, she is meticulous about the condition of water, feed and the overall environment in which the fish are raised. She is well known for climbing in the tanks to personally taste each and every egg before harvest. Her relentless energy and insistence on quality has made her one of the most respected and well-known leaders in the caviar industry.

The California Caviar Company is the only vertically integrated caviar company in the U.S.

CCC's seasoned and dedicated team of experts work 24/7 insuring the health and wellness of the farm and its many inhabitants. The company's sturgeon team spawn and raise pure indigenous breed of sturgeon solely at CQ Ranch until harvest.
